Penguin Update, what I've noticed
-
Hi Guys, I have spent 2 days looking at our site and competitors after the update, 3 things jump out straight away for us. I am in the travel industry and still on the first page of the major KW's but in the 8 to 10 region, was 2 to 5.
1. The sites that have moved up both have shops selling merchandise which is not the main focus of their site, anyone else spotted sites with a eCommerce section have benefited from latest update?
2. Sites we have links from, although they look like a travel sites, maybe be themed differently by Google. Anybody know a good tool that will help determine what theme a site is? Images, design and content don't always seem to be a good indicator, I think back links to the domain has a big effect on the site you get the link from. Any tool that will help speed up this process would be great. We need more quality links from travel sites (or at least what google thinks is a travel related site).
3. The competitors who have done well seem to have 45% links to home page, we only had 28% so we are focusing now on links to home page.
We don't really stand out from the top 10 sites in any other way in terms of other indicators like branded keywords vrs money making kw's.
Any thoughts or feedback would be great.

I think alot off people are not taking into account about the penguin 2.0 update its site that are backlinking to you might be devalued.
So you look at your own backlink profile and you think its ok, but the backlink profile of the site that backlink to you might have hand there authority reduced (maybe even penalised). And then what about the backlinks to the backlink of the backlinks ( backlInkception)
My under standing is that penguin 2.0 is only about backlink profiles (like 1.0), and everything else is speculation at this stage without a lot of research.
I'm not saying what your have noted is not correct, just that there are far to many variables at this stage to come to any conclusions and some bigger research needs to be done on it.
"so we are focusing now on links to home page" I think that might be a good idea, more links to the homepage would look more natural IMO
